Features - CIN II:<ref name=Ref_PBoD1075-6>{{Ref PBoD|1075-6}}</ref>
{{Main|High-grade squamous intraepithelial lesion}}
*Increased nuclear-cytoplasmic ratio, loss of polarity, incr. mitoses, hyperchromasia.
**If there are large nuclei... you should seen 'em on low power, i.e. 25x.
 
Notes:
#Hyperchromasia is a very useful feature for identifying CIN (particularly at low power, i.e. 25x).
#Koilocytes are the key feature of CIN I.
#Koilocytes are ''not'' considered to be part of a CIN II lesion or CIN III lesion.
#Large irregular nuclei are not required for CIN II... but you should think about it.
#Some mild changes at the squamo-columnar junction are expected.
#Look for the location of mitoses...
#* If there is a mitosis in the inner third (of the epithelial layer) = think CIN I. 
#* If there is a mitosis in the middle third (of the epithelial layer) = think CIN II.
#* If there is a mitosis in the outer third = think CIN III.
#Prominent [[nucleoli]] are ''not'' present in CIN.<ref name=Ref_GP146>{{Ref GP|146}}</ref>
#*Nucleoli are common in reactive changes.<ref>STC. January 2009.</ref>

===Micro===
====CIN 2====
The sections show the transformation zone.
The squamous epithelium has a moderately increased nuclear-to-cytoplasmic ratio, and
nuclear hyperchromasia extending to the mid level of the epithelium. Binucleation
is present. A mid level mitoses is seen in one section.
A p16 immunostain, within the limits of the tissue orientation, focally marks (in the
suspicious area) weakly the full thickness of the squamous epithelium and strongly
marks up to the lower half of the epithelium. A Ki-67 immunostain marks increased numbers of
superficial epithelial cells.
====CIN 3====
The sections show the transformation zone.
The squamous epithelium has an increased nuclear-cytoplasmic ratio, loss of polarity, mitoses and nuclear hyperchromasia extending to the superficial third of the epithelium.  Mitoses are seen in the upper third of the epithelium.  No nucleoli are present. No invasion is identified.
The columnar epithelium has focal involvement by the squamous lesion.  There is no columnar dysplasia.  The margins are negative for dysplasia.
